sobiga3 发表于 2005-4-12 10:13:00

[求助]怎样通过样条曲线上的一点画它的切线

如题

CADghost 发表于 2005-4-12 11:23:00

设置捕捉切点

xqyhome 发表于 2005-4-12 12:03:00

14期电脑报CAD大考场是这么回答的,晕死!

第一步:先在命令行中输入快捷键C创建一个适当大小的圆.<BR>                                             第二步:单击"绘图/块/定义属性",在弹出的属性定义对话框中,拾取点选择圆心,标记定为1,以正方的中间对正,选择合适的文字样式和高度,确定.<BR>                                              第三步:在命令行中输入快捷键B建立块,不妨命名为num,拾取点不妨设为象限点,然后选择建立好的圆和数字,确定,然后在弹出的编辑属性对话框中将空白区域填为2(只有一个地方可填).<BR>                             第四步:在你所需要插入带圈的数字的地方插入块(快捷键为I),在命令行中输入你所需要的数字,回车(不可用空格确定,必须是回车确定).这样就建立了带圈的数字.<BR>                               注:在第二步和第三步中,不是必须标记为1和2,可以随便标记,但两步中最好不要标记为同一数字<BR>



这样行不行呢?


在命令行中输入XL(命令xline),提示“指定点或 [水平(H)/垂直(V)/角度(A)/二等分(B)/偏移(O)]:”点击对象捕捉工具条中的“捕捉到切点(tan)”后在样条曲线上选择一个点,在选择一个指定通过点后回车。<BR><BR>XLINE创建的无限长直线,通常称为参照线,这类线通常作为辅助作图线使用。

柯梦楠 发表于 2005-4-12 12:57:00

楼上说的构造线是能够保证与样条曲线相切,但是第一个指定的点为虚拟点,会随着第二点的位置而变化,这样也就不能保证第一点的位置了!这也就和从样条曲线外一点做他的切线没有分别了!


而楼主说的,“样条曲线上的一点”,请问楼主,你所说的这个点你又怎么去确定呢?你怎么能确定样条曲线上的哪个点是你要的点????


在我看来,这种问法本来就有问题!除非楼主有办法确定样条曲线上你所要的那个点的位置!

sobiga3 发表于 2005-4-12 14:26:00

我也看到了电脑报上的文章,这个点很好确定,比如一条直线与本样条曲线的交点,等等。

xqyhome 发表于 2005-4-12 14:39:00

sobiga3发表于2005-4-12 14:26:00static/image/common/back.gif这个点很好确定,比如一条直线与本样条曲线的交点,等等。


<BR>如何确定这个点?


“一条直线与本样条曲线的交点”有命令或系统变量???

syc2008200 发表于 2005-4-12 17:04:00

<A name=22737><FONT color=#990000><B>CADghost</B></FONT></A>设置捕捉切点       


<A name=22754><FONT color=#000066><B>xqyhome</B></FONT></A>在命令行中输入XL(命令xline),提示“指定点或 [水平(H)/垂直(V)/角度(A)/二等分(B)/偏移(O)]:”点击对象捕捉工具条中的“捕捉到切点(tan)”后在样条曲线上选择一个点,在选择一个指定通过点后回车                       


xline 第一步在样条线上捕捉切点,第二步取消捕捉 找定位的另外一点即可。我认为行得通       


柯梦楠 发表于 2005-4-14 13:28:00

行不通,你可以试着画一条样条曲线,再画一条直线与其相交,在交点处画样条曲线的切线!用那种方法做不出的!

haobo 发表于 2005-4-14 22:42:00

这样子是画不出切线的,只是近似相切!


我还可以利用这种办法画出交线来!

xqyhome 发表于 2005-4-15 21:00:00

<A href="http://bbs.cpcw.com/index.php" target="_blank" ><FONT color=#000000>《电脑报》读者论坛</FONT></A>                       <A href="http://bbs.cpcw.com/forumdisplay.php?fid=84&amp;page=1" target="_blank" ><FONT color=#000000>我要评报</FONT></A>       <A class=bold href="http://bbs.cpcw.com/viewpro.php?uid=268813" target="_blank" ><b><FONT color=#003366>zd824</FONT></b></A>       2005-4-15 18:29发的帖子


电脑报2005-4-11即14期的软件CAD版严重出错!!<BR><BR>该期有一个CAD专业问题是:怎样在一条spline线的已知点上做该线的切线。<BR>但是,该答案却是怎样快速输入带圆圈的数字或字母。


<SPAN style="FONT-SIZE: 12px">我把正确的答案说一下吧:<BR>首先copy该spline.<BR>在该spline线上已知点打断spline成两段<BR>向曲率外偏置任意一段一个适当的植<BR>连接偏好的线端点(靠近已知点的)到已知点做辅助直线<BR>旋转辅助直线90度即为我们要的切线了。 <BR>

</SPAN>
页: [1] 2
查看完整版本: [求助]怎样通过样条曲线上的一点画它的切线